Our changing coastline

​Action area C2. Address the effects of climate change on our coastline

  • Establish long-term management approach for our changing coastline, and work with mana whenua and communities to create and deliver coastal management plans.
  • Undertake a regional coastal erosion study and a coastal hazard vulnerability assessment and work with communities to discuss options and prepare them for the future.
  • Support iwi and hapū to account for climate change impacts from sea level rise.
  • Incorporate protection, managed retreat and restoration of indigenous coastal ecosystems into planning for sea level change.
  • Develop a tsunami hazard model that takes sea level rise impacts into account .
  • Review provisions in the Auckland Unitary Plan (AUP) from a coast and natural hazards perspective and use this to inform the statutory review of the AUP and future plan changes.
